Wild Seed: Chapter 8

A specific trigger warning for this chapter, for abusive relationship. Anyanwu helps her daughter Nweke in her transition; Doro leaves them to it. We see anew the power of Anyanwu’s empathy, and Doro’s inability to understand it. We learn of Nweke’s fraught conception, rooted in punishment, power, and death. Toshi and adrienne explore chapter 8 of Octavia E. Butler’s Wild Seed. And as always, offer questions for you and your people to consider.
